The Department of Labor and Employment is encouraging barbers, beauticians, manicurists, massage therapists, and other workers in the informal sector to become members of the Social Security System so they can avail of housing and salary loans in the future.
Labor Secretary Patricia Sto. Tomas said the informal sector workers could borrow money from the SSS and use it to start a business of their own.

[Summary] => Tricycle drivers would also soon become beneficiaries of the Social Security System.
Recently, the Department of Labor and Employment announced that it had linked up with private sectors like San Miguel Corporation and Philippine Savings Bank to help the tricycle drivers by paying the counterpart of their monthly premium contributions.
